Below are 3 vital visual signs to look for when view casting:

1.Nervous water: A mild disruption externally of the water, often indicating the visibility of a fish.
2.Pushing water: A noticeable "V" shape produced by a fish swimming through the water, displacing it as it relocates.
3.Birds diving: Birds diving right into the water, indicating the visibility of baitfish, which subsequently bring in killers.

Checking out the Water for Reds and Snook



You'll need to develop a keen eye for structure and environment to locate the evasive redfish and snook that call the Everglades' backcountry home. As you browse the winding waters, take note of the subtle modifications in water patterns and structural aspects that signal the presence of your target types.

1.Oyster bars and mangrove shorelines: These areas give vital habitat for redfish and snook, providing shelter, food, and ambush points. Seek locations with dense mangrove protection, oyster bars, and refined modifications in water depth.
2.Tidal circulations and currents: Understand just how the tides influence the activity of fish. As the tide climbs, redfish and snook frequently relocate right into superficial waters to feed, while falling tides can concentrate them in deeper networks.
3.Submerged frameworks and drop-offs: Pay interest to submerged logs, rocks, and drop-offs, which can draw in predators like snook and redfish. These areas frequently offer ambush points, shelter, and feeding chances.

Approaches for Catching Tarpon and Snappers



Tarpon and snappers require a various collection of skills and methods, and grasping these will land you a treasured catch in the Everglades' backcountry. You'll require to adjust to their unique habits and environments to reel them in. When targeting tarpon, understanding their actions is vital. These silver titans are recognized to roll and feed upon the surface area, specifically during dawn and sunset when baitfish are most energetic. Seek areas with good water flow, like creek mouths or channel sides, where tarpon often tend to gather. Usage live bait or appeals that imitate their health food resources, and be gotten ready for a tough fight.

Snappers, on the other hand, populate specific habitats that call for a different method. You'll find them in locations with framework, such as mangrove shorelines, rough outcroppings, or sunken logs. Snappers are ambush killers, waiting for unwary prey to stray by. Use live or reduce bait, and fish near the base or simply over the framework. Hold your horses, as snappers can be finicky, however the reward is well worth the delay. Managing Mosquitoes and Sun Exposure



What's your strategy for making it through the relentless assault of mosquitoes and blistering sun that can promptly turn a desire fishing journey right into a problem in the Everglades backcountry? You're not alone if you're assuming, "I'll simply persist." But depend on us, you won't last long without a solid strategy to battle these two powerful foes.

Secure Yourself

1.Insect Repellent: Bring a trustworthy insect repellent which contains DEET, picaridin, or oil of lemon eucalyptus. Apply it frequently, especially throughout peak mosquito hours (dawn and dusk).
2.Sunscreen Options: Pack broad-spectrum sun block with high SPF, lip balm with SPF, and a hat to shield your face and neck. Reapply every two hours or quickly after swimming or sweating.
3.Lightweight, Light-Colored Clothing: Wear loose, breathable garments that covers your skin, reducing subjected locations for mosquitoes to target.

Pine Island Sound Fishing Havens



As you navigate the serene waters of Pine Island Sound, you'll find out covert treasures like Captiva Pass, where tarpon, snook, and also redfish await in the mangrove-lined shores as well as superficial apartments. The noise's distinct mix of tidal gaps and also seagrass apartments produces a fisher's paradise. You'll locate your own self surrounded by an wealth of aquatic lifestyle, along with fish varieties that prosper in these habitats.

As you explore the audio, you'll see the tidal crevices, where the water streams in and out, creating ideal ambush locations for predators like snook and also redfish. These holes are especially effective throughout the modifying tides, when fish are actually much more active. At the same time, the seagrass flats give a sanctuary for varieties like tarpon, which live on the rich crustaceans and small fish that dwell these places.

When fishing Pine Island Sound, it is actually vital to be actually mindful of the tides as well as the water's quality. In the course of the clear water time frames, you can sight-fish for species like tarpon and also snook, while dirty waters frequently require a additional responsive approach, utilizing lures or reside lure to attract attacks. Matlacha Pass Mangrove Hotspots



Matlacha Pass, a narrow river separating Pine Island from the mainland, holds its very own secrets, as well as you'll find mangrove-lined shores as well as oyster bars including fish, waiting to be actually discovered. As you browse the pass, you'll discover the Matlacha shores are populated along with mangrove tunnels, generating a maze of fishing possibilities. These passages deliver home for fish, creating them perfect ambush aspects for killers like snook and redfish.

You'll would like to check out the mangrove-lined banks, where snappers as well as trout often gather. Seek locations with excellent water circulation, as these often tend to bring in more fish. As you make your means with the pass, watch out for oyster pubs, which may be hotspots for catching sheepshead and black drum. Ensure to fish the edges of these bars, where the design as well as baitfish attract much larger predators.

When fishing Matlacha Pass, it is actually important to keep an eye on the tides. The transforming water table can easily reveal or even hide fishing hotspots, therefore be prepared to conform your approach correctly.
